Carte Blanche, produced by Combined Artistic Productions, launched the Carte Blanche Making a Difference Trust (IT 3593/2008) to commemorate 20 years on air in August 2008. George Mazarakis, Carte Blanche’s Executive Producer, set the goal of raising R20-million, a million for every year on air, to support State paediatric units across the country. To date, through the generosity of corporate donors and viewers, we have more than quadrupled that target. In 2010, George (Trustee) and Karolina Andropoulos (patron) were awarded the Support of Philanthropy in the Media Inyathelo Philanthropy Award for their work in equipping paediatric units in hospitals with life-saving equipment and mobilising corporate and private South Africa to donate millions of rands to support this initiative. For well over a decade, the Making A Difference Trust, together Hospital Design Group have built healthcare facilities for children in public hospitals across the country. These high-end critical care paediatric facilities are the most specialised and rare resources anywhere in the world, and particularly so in our public hospitals. The collaboration has had direct impact on enabling access to outstanding healthcare resources to over 300 000 children. These children have been the beneficiaries of the partnership of the Making A Difference Trust and Hospital Design Group.
